- Total nursing staff turnover
- 39.2% — lower than most Washington nursing homesWashington avg: 45.9% · National avg: 46.1% · per CMS Care Compare
- RN turnover
- 16.7% — lower than most Washington nursing homesWashington avg: 46.8% · National avg: 43.3% · per CMS Care Compare
- Administrators who left
- 0 departed — near the Washington averageWashington avg: 0.6 · National avg: 0.5 · per CMS Care Compare

Federal ownership record
Chain affiliation
Part of the Vertical Health Services chain — 16 facilities across 3 states. Chain-wide average overall rating 1.8 / 5.
Disclosed owners (5 on record)
- Bridgeport Way w Consulting Llc
Adp of The Snf · since 2025
- Joseph c Denor
Adp of The Snf · since 2025
- Larry Shurman
Adp of The Snf · since 2025
- William Miller
Operational/managerial Control · 100% · since 2023
- Vhs wa Opco Holdings LlcHolding
Direct Ownership Interest · 100% · since 2023
Recent change of ownership
September 2023 (2 years ago) · acquired from Arcadia Medical Resort of University Place
Transaction type: Change of Ownership

Federal inspection record
Recent health-deficiency citations (most recent 8 of 34)
- D0745·Nov 25, 2025Complaint
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ide medically-related social services to help each resident achieve the highest possible quality of life.
- E0695·Nov 25, 2025Complaint
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ide safe and appropriate respiratory care for a resident when needed.
- E0610·Nov 25, 2025Complaint
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ies
Respond appropriately to all alleged violations.
- E0812·Apr 11, 2025
Nutrition and Dietary Deficiencies
Procure food from sources approved or considered satisfactory and store, prepare, distribute and serve food in accordance with professional standards.
- D0804·Apr 11, 2025
Nutrition and Dietary Deficiencies
Ensure food and drink is palatable, attractive, and at a safe and appetizing temperature.
- D0791·Apr 11, 2025
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ide or obtain dental services for each resident.
- D0790·Apr 11, 2025
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
Provide routine and 24-hour emergency dental care for each resident.
- E0757·Apr 11, 2025
Pharmacy Service Deficiencies
Ensure each resident’s drug regimen must be free from unnecessary drugs.
Fire-safety citations
27 Life-Safety-Code citations on file. Most recent: Apr 11, 2025. Fire-safety inspections cover building-level Life Safety Code compliance, separate from the resident-care health survey.
